Clear Creek facts for kids
Clear Creek is a common name used for many different places, like rivers, towns, and even nature parks, mostly in the United States. When you see "Clear Creek," it could be talking about one of these many places!
Rivers and Streams
Many rivers and streams across the United States are called Clear Creek. These waterways often get their name because their water is very clear, making it easy to see the bottom.
Famous Clear Creeks
- Clear Creek (Colorado): This river in Colorado is very famous because it was a big part of the Colorado Gold Rush. Many people came here looking for gold in the mid-1800s.
- Clear Creek (Utah): This creek in Utah is known for its interesting Fremont culture archaeological finds. The Fremont people were ancient Native Americans who lived in this area.
- Clear Creek (Atlanta): This stream flows through Atlanta, Georgia, and is a tributary of Peachtree Creek.
- Clear Creek (Arizona): This creek is a northern tributary in the amazing Grand Canyon. It's also home to the Clear Creek Reservoir.
- Clear Creek (Pennsylvania): This creek flows into the Clarion River in northwestern Pennsylvania.
- Clear Creek (Washington): This stream is a tributary of the Sauk River.

Towns and Places
Besides rivers, several towns and areas are also named Clear Creek.
Places in the United States
- Clear Creek, Utah: This is a virtual ghost town in Carbon County. It used to be a coal mining town.
- Clear Creek County, Colorado: This county in Colorado is named after the famous Clear Creek river that runs through it, known for its gold rush history.
- League City, Texas: This city was actually called "Clear Creek" a long time ago.
- Clear Creek, Indiana: This is an unincorporated place in Monroe County.
- Clear Creek, Minnesota: This is an unorganized territory in Carlton County.
- There are also places called Clear Creek in Butte County, California, Lassen County, California, Siskiyou County, California, and Virginia.
Places in Canada
- Clear Creek, Ontario: This is a farming community in Norfolk County, Canada.
